AQUAMARINE AND DIAMOND BRACELET, CARTIER, PARIS, CIRCA 1940. The flexible strap decorated in a loosely woven pattern with baguette, cushion-shaped and lozenge-shaped aquamarines, studded at intervals with round diamonds, the clasp set with an emerald-cut aquamarine weighing approximately 2.60 carats, mounted in platinum and 18 karat white gold, length 6 ¼ inches, signed Cartier, Paris, numbered 93853, maker's mark, assay marks.
